How compound and complex sentences are alike?

A compound sentence contains two independent clauses joined by a coordinator, coordinators are always preceded by a comma. A complex sentence has an independent clause joined by one or more dependent clauses. A complex sentence always has a subordinator such as because, since, after, although, or when or a relative pronoun such as that, who, or which.

Kind of sentence according to structure and there meanings?

Sentences can be categorized by structure into four main types: simple, compound, complex, and compound-complex. A simple sentence contains a single independent clause, while a compound sentence consists of two or more independent clauses joined by a conjunction. Complex sentences have one independent clause and at least one dependent clause, and compound-complex sentences combine elements of both compound and complex structures. Each type serves different purposes in conveying meaning and complexity in writing.


Compound sentences are joined by a?

Compound sentences are joined by a coordinating conjunction (such as and, but, or, so), a semicolon, or a conjunctive adverb (such as however, therefore).


How can clauses be joined together?

Clauses can be joined together using coordinating conjunctions (e.g. and, but, or), subordinating conjunctions (e.g. because, although, while), and relative pronouns (e.g. who, which, that). This allows you to create complex sentences by connecting independent and dependent clauses.
